Benefits of a Bean Coffee Machine Bean coffee machines offer a range of beverages to satisfy every coffee craving. They keep whole beans in a hopper, and grind them prior to making coffee. This gives the freshest taste and aroma that cannot be duplicated by coffee that has been pre-ground. You can also use them to texturize milk and make cappuccinos and lattes. So why choose a bean-based coffee machine? Convenience Bean to cup machines are made to offer barista quality coffee and can be used by anyone. The machine will take care of everything for you. You only need to add beans and milk, select your drink, and then press a button. The coffee machine grinds beans, extract the drink and even make fresh milk that is frothy for you. They are very user-friendly, making them a great choice for workplaces. Your employees can self-serve their coffee without any formal training. Ease of use One of the greatest advantages that a bean coffee machine offers over its pod and capsule competitors is the ease of use. They are pre-programmed to offer a selection of drinks, and users can choose their preferred one at the push of an button. The machine will then crush the beans, measure them, then tamp them and then force hot water through them to make the drink. This means there is no room for human error, and the drink will be made to a uniform standard. Freshness Bean to cup machines grind the entire bean before extraction, unlike pre-ground coffee or pre-packaged coffee that can become dull over time and lose their flavour. This guarantees the best taste and maximum flavor. This is especially important when it comes to espresso, where the freshness of the coffee is crucial to the quality of the espresso. Commercial coffee machines that are bean-to-cup automate the barista's job in a café, and are increasingly popular among people who want to enjoy the freshness of freshly prepared coffee. They have an integrated water system, brewing unit, and grinder. This lets them make a delicious and fresh cup of coffee. Most also have an adjustable control panel that allows you to personalize your beverage by selecting the desired temperature and strength, as well as brew size. Some offer programmable recipes and others feature touchscreens or digital displays that offer an easy and intuitive way to navigate through the options. In comparison to pod-based systems, bean to cup coffee machines generate less waste, which is beneficial for the environment as well as your budget. Pods are made up of ground coffee beans, coffee beans and plastic packaging. They can end up in landfills creating environmental issues. Bean to cup machines on the other hand utilize large quantities of coffee beans and produce a small amount coffee waste that can be reused or composted.
